TURN-208: Gatevale turnstile counters at the Merrow Field pilot double-count when a rotation reverses mid-cycle. Attendance totals drift roughly 2% high per event. The debounce window fix is implemented, reviewed by Ilsa, and soak-tested across two simulated match days without drift. Ready for your cut; the candidate build is identified below.

trace token, tagag-tafog: htk6_5ed18c

Loyalty Overhaul — Managers Only

Quick heads-up for finance: the Starpoint programme revamp kicks off next quarter. We're scrapping tier expiry and doubling redemption options at Brightmart locations. Expect a one-off accrual adjustment of roughly 3% of deferred revenue. Modelling sheets land Friday — flag anything odd early. The bigger commercial picture is noted below.

board note of bawep-tajef: Queniusek Systems plans to raise the Quenvan list price by 53.1 percent in March. The pricing group signed off on a budget of $176.4 million for Project Drueth. The renewal with Casionix Partners closes at $142.5 million a year, 8.3 percent below the last contract. Project Fraax slips by six weeks because of the tooling delay.

### Calendar Sync Conflict

If Daybridge shows duplicate events after a sync, it's almost always a stale cursor on the Wrenfield connector. Pause the sync job, clear the cursor table, and resync from the last checkpoint — takes about five minutes. You'll need to authenticate against the internal sync service with the key below.

gateway credential: kto3_qfe

## Idempotency Keys for Payment Retries (Lumopay)

Every retry of a charge request must reuse the original idempotency key; generating a new key on retry can produce duplicate charges. Keys are scoped per merchant and expire after 48 hours. Reviewers should verify keys are derived server-side, never from client input. The full key-generation specification and threat model are maintained on the internal page.

dashboard of kaguf-tawip = https://vault.merlaqsys.test/issue

### Step 4: Cut over the partner SFTP drop

After the Brackenford feeds are verified, repoint the ingest worker from the legacy drop to the new one. Confirm checksums match for the last three deliveries before flipping the flag in `ingest.toml`. The worker logs each file into the manifest database, so new hires should verify rows appear there. Connect to the manifest database using the string below.

primary connection of kajop-yahap = postgresql://pelax_svc:EQ@db-49fe.tolvaqgrid.example:5432/zormir